Chalk Hill Sonoma Coast - Chardonnay
Low stock: 1 left
The palate has a rich textural body composed by zest and acidity with flavors of toasted hazelnut, vanilla and crème brûlée. With its cool-climate influences, this Chardonnay has remarkable varietal intensity, balanced acidity and minerality that complement the rich and full flavors on the palate.

Tasting Notes: Rich and elegant with flavors of apple, pear, and a touch of oak and vanilla.
Pairings:
Seafood: Lobster, crab cakes, or rich fish like salmon.
Poultry: Roast chicken, turkey with creamy sauces.
Pasta: Creamy Alfredo or risotto.
Cheese: Aged cheddar, Gouda, or Brie.

About the Brand
Chalk Hill, founded in 1990 and located in Sonoma County, California, is a well-regarded winery known for producing high-quality wines that reflect the diverse terroir of the region. The estate is particularly renowned for its Chardonnay, which showcases the balance and complexity achieved through meticulous vineyard management and winemaking practices. Chalk Hill also offers a range of other varietals, including Sauvignon Blanc, Cabernet Sauvignon, and Pinot Noir. The winery emphasizes sustainability and a commitment to crafting wines that express both the unique characteristics of their vineyards and the elegance of Sonoma County's cool-climate environment.
